Washington Park Homes for Sale in Denver CO

The architecturally diverse Wash Park neighborhood boasts one of the highest percentages of historic homes in all of Denver. Bungalows, Denver Squares, Victorians, and duplexes dominate, but you’ll find some “scrape-offs” and “pop-tops” scattered among Wash Park West real estate as well. When you're buying in Wash Park, you'll want to spend more time outdoors than in.

Was Park Garden Center

Mature trees, know-your-neighbor streets, and landscaped lawns make Wash Park—as the locals call it—a highly coveted area. Surrounding and facing the park are bungalows and duplexes that have been preserved and expanded, as well as some extravagant new-builds. The views of—and access to—Denver's most popular park make this neighborhood on the pricier side, but the village-esque feel, with ice cream and baby strollers, make it all worthwhile.

About Washington Park

Wash Park East is located between Cherry Creek, I-25, University and Downing. Wash Park West is positioned between Alameda, I-25, Downing, and Broadway. The following reasons make this community one of hottest Denver neighborhood:

  • HISTORIC HOMES Wash Park East real estate displays home styles from the craftsman bungalow on the east, to Victorian on the west. 
  • CENTRAL LOCATION. This hip neighborhood is as central as they come with Denver's most popular park within walking distance. Residents here also enjoy proximity to the conveniences, restaurants and music venues of the popular South Broadway district and quick access to I-25. Walk, bike or rollerblade to any convenience you need; flowers, stationery, gardening tools, dinner, drinks or just a shopping fix (particularly along Old South Gaylord).
  • WASH PARK - Stop by on any 50-plus degree day and frolic in the 161-acre sanctuary. You'll see volleyball leagues, soccer games, tennis tournaments, one-on-one basketball, picnickers, 5k charity runs, cyclists, athletic training groups and walkers stopping to smell the colorful flower beds along Downing.
  • GREAT NEIGHBORHOOD This neighborhood is the epitome of Denver living. Washington Park provides for the ultimate Denver lifestyle: active, healthy, diverse, and laid back.

Don’t miss Old South Pearl Street and Old South Gaylord Street, where quaint shops and hip restaurants abound. 

South High School's clock tower rises at the southeast corner of the area, while the Marion Parkway high rises can be seen from almost anywhere in the city.
